Bunkerhill AVG is a software device intended for use in detecting presence and estimating quantity of aortic valve calcification for adult patients aged 40 years and above. The device automatically analyzes non-gated, non-contrast chest computed tomography (CT) images collected during clinical care and outputs the region of interest (intended for informational purposes only) and quantification of detected calcium. The output of the subject device is made available to the physician on-demand as part of his or her standard workflow. The device-generated quantification can be viewed in the patient report at the discretion of the physician, and the physician also has the option of viewing the device-generated calcium region of interest in a diagnostic image viewer. The subject device output in no way replaces the original patient report or the original non-gated, non-contrast CT scan; both are still available to be viewed and used at the discretion of the physician. The device is intended to provide information to the physician to provide assistance during review of the patient's case. Results of the subject device are not intended to be used on a stand-alone basis and are solely intended to aid and provide information to the physician. In all cases, further action taken on a patient should only come at the recommendation of the physician after further reviewing the patient's results.

Regulatory identity
FDA record and catalog context
The FDA listing establishes the regulatory identity. It does not by itself establish local workflow fit, pricing, security, or performance in your environment.
FDA submission
K243229
